NEW BRUNSWICK, N.J. (1010 WINS) — The man accused of fatally stabbing two men in a double homicide in New Jersey Saturday night took his own life Sunday morning, according to authorities.

The two victims—Gabriela De La Cruz Camero, 22, and Jesus Antonio-Salazar, 25—were found stabbed around 11 p.m. Camero was discovered near the park, while Antonio-Salazar was found inside the park.

Antonio-Salazar was pronounced dead on the scene and Camero was taken to Robert Wood Johnson University Hospital where he later died, prosecutors said.

Hours later, police discovered 26-year-old Eduardo Mateo Lorenzo, dead about a half mile from the park.

Investigators believe that Lorenzo knew both victims and stabbed them before taking his own life, prosecutors said.

An investigation is ongoing.
